Three UK Buys UK Broadband and a Bunch of Spectrum for £250m

Challenger MNO Three UK is buying UK Broadband for £250 million in an apparent bid to improve its fixed wireless offering and to grab a chunk of high-frequency spectrum...

Broadband Vouchers Worth £3000 for SMEs to Help Boost Coverage

Small businesses will be given up to £3,000 worth in broadband vouchers to help boost coverage across Britain, under plans being considered for the Budget.
